Exports top $400bn for 1st time, fastest expansion since 2009-10

Export of Indian goods topped the $400-billion mark for the first time, led by higher engineering goods, electronics and food products, with another $10-12 billion worth of products expected to be shipped during the remaining nine days of the financial year. So far this year, exports are estimated to have increased 37% from last year’s level of $291 billion, making this the fastest pace of expansion since the over 40% growth registered in 2009-10, according to data available on the RBI website. from Times of India https://ift.tt/JwkjToq via IFTTT

US to declare Myanmar’s military committed genocide

Five years after Myanmar’s military began a killing spree against ethnic Rohingya, driving nearly 1 million people from their country, the United States has concluded that the widespread campaign of rape, crucifixions, and drownings and burnings of families and children amounted to genocide. Secretary of State Antony Blinken is set to announce the determination. from Times of India https://ift.tt/6sOgc7n via IFTTT

Hijab row: Focus back on Sabarimala case pending before SC

The SC in 2019, by a 4:1 verdict held that devotees of Lord Ayyappa do not constitute a separate religious denomination and therefore cannot claim the benefit of Article 26 of the Constitution. It also concluded that bar on entry of women in the 10-50 years' age group into the temple is violative of Article 25 of the Constitution. This was challenged by way of review petitions when the court by a 3:2 decision referred the questions of law to a larger bench. from Times of India https://ift.tt/NPCgBQD via IFTTT
